From 1cfcb783c231fc1027424e68cfbaab1b391b77a1 Mon Sep 17 00:00:00 2001 From: loathingKernel <142770+loathingKernel@users.noreply.github.com> Date: Sat, 20 Jan 2024 16:19:49 +0200 Subject: [PATCH] EnvVars: Add `MANGOHUD` as read-only --- rare/components/tabs/settings/widgets/env_vars_model.py |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) diff --git a/rare/components/tabs/settings/widgets/env_vars_model.py b/rare/components/tabs/settings/widgets/env_vars_model.py index fdf03b38..29ca61b5 100644 --- a/rare/components/tabs/settings/widgets/env_vars_model.py +++ b/rare/components/tabs/settings/widgets/env_vars_model.py @@ -28,14 +28,15 @@ class EnvVarsTableModel(QAbstractTableModel): self.__validator = re.compile(r"(^[A-Za-z_][A-Za-z0-9_]*)") self.__data_map: ChainMap = ChainMap() - self.__readonly = [ + self.__readonly = { "DXVK_HUD", + "MANGOHUD", "MANGOHUD_CONFIG", - ] + } if platform.system() != "Windows": - self.__readonly.extend(get_wine_environment().keys()) + self.__readonly.update(get_wine_environment().keys()) if platform.system() in {"Linux", "FreeBSD"}: - self.__readonly.extend(get_steam_environment().keys()) + self.__readonly.update(get_steam_environment().keys()) self.__default: str = "default" self.__appname: str = None